  1. Just to clarify, Seth actually has better all-around growths than all of the cavaliers you get in the game. If this isn't a troll I don't know what this is. Joshua is sword-locked in an enemy-phase game. He's certainly no Rutger because the passive CRIT is lowered. Fun fact: he'll only have on average around 13 strength at a Lvl 20 myrmidon. Obviously you got very lucky with your Joshua. Tana is technically a better unit statistically than Vanessa, it's just her weak join time and Vanessa's easy availability and level lead that puts her over Tana. It's not like even in the endgame Vanessa's much worse than Tana statistically, you'll most likely be using both anyways. It's not about enjoyment of the game, Moulder is just strictly better than Natasha. He gets a level lead and that's the deciding factor between the two. I would agree with you that Natasha is underrated, but tier lists can't be made off personal experience.

  12. I think that Canto is fine as it is (just no FE4 canto, please). Canto makes sense for horse units- attack and retreat. The main problem is fixing mounted units in general. Dismount sounds like a good idea (I’ve heard that Thracia had this mechanism). Or, give everyone canto or remove canto entirely. Obviously this doesn’t even scratch the surface but this is just from the top of my head. I’ll think of more stuff later.

To be fair to all the people asking for FE4 remakes and the like (although I would prefer Thracia first because I never got to play an English version of it-or at best a poorly translated one that made life hell), it (in my humble opinion), is probably not going to happen in the next FE. Video game producers want to follow up on the heels of a successful video game with more fresh concepts and such that make the game more and more interesting, and then when interest has died down a little bit, they can consider doing something else. Just look at Awakening. After that, the producers went into a 3 year long think and came out with Fates, a jumbo-pack of...ideas! to say the least. Obviously the developers were on LSD or something, because they came out with Fates. But, they tried. Oh well. Anyways, following on the massive success of Three Houses, I don't think Nintendo and Intelligent Systems will pull back so quickly. The newer fans are hungry for more material, and they will not be denied their feast. Of course, a new game will also be devoured by older FE fans, so it is probably in Nintendo's best interests to release new games, not remakes. It's a win-win.
